What is a 35M Civilian?

A 35M Civilian job refers to a civilian role that supports Human Intelligence (HUMINT) operations, typically within the Department of Defense or other government agencies. These professionals assist in gathering, analyzing, and interpreting intelligence from human sources to support military or national security objectives. Their duties may include conducting interviews, debriefing sources, translating foreign languages, and compiling intelligence reports. Civilian 35M roles often require experience in military intelligence, foreign languages, or investigative work. Depending on the position, a security clearance may be necessary.

What are the typical daily responsibilities of a 35M Civilian?

As a 35M Civilian Human Intelligence Collector, your typical day may involve conducting interviews and debriefings, collecting and analyzing information, preparing intelligence reports, and coordinating with military and government personnel. You may also attend briefings, process sensitive material, and support mission planning with actionable insights. Working as part of a multidisciplinary team, you are expected to maintain strict confidentiality and adhere to established protocols. This role requires both independent work and close collaboration to ensure high-quality, reliable intelligence products.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a 35M Civilian?

To excel as a 35M Civilian (Human Intelligence Collector supporting the military in a civilian capacity), you need strong analytical abilities, attention to detail, and experience in intelligence gathering or analysis, often with a relevant degree or prior military/DoD experience. Familiarity with intelligence collection tools, reporting databases, and security clearance requirements is commonly expected. Outstanding interpersonal skills, adaptability, and discretion are crucial for building rapport and managing sensitive information. These skills ensure effective information collection, secure communication, and meaningful contributions to mission-critical intelligence operations.
